This was a truly wonderful morning and 7 of us started it thusly:
Partner up and run around the block. Run behind the school to concession area. 20 dips, 20 squats, and 20 jump ups
Partner 1 runs to playground on the right – 10 pull-ups, 20 merkins – then runs around the ball field and back to concession stand
Partner 2 runs to playground on the left – 15 hanging knees-to-elbows – then runs around opposite ball field back to concession stand
Repeat and flapjack until 6:05, then finished with the HT Mile.
